Description
Substantial private country residence set in approximately three acres of gardens and woodland. This distinguished property benefits from an indoor swimming pool, sauna, gym, and an impressive annexe.

Dating back to the 1960s with subsequent extensions, the main residence extends to over 5,500 sq ft and is arranged over two floors. Surrounded by beautifully landscaped gardens and woodland, the property is approached via a gated sweeping driveway.

Upon entering, an entrance hall provides access to four generously proportioned reception rooms. The heart of the home is the bespoke kitchen/breakfast room, fitted with handcrafted solid oak units and featuring French doors that open onto a courtyard. A separate utility room complements the kitchen.

The north wing of the property houses the indoor heated swimming pool and sauna with adjoining changing and shower facilities, a gymnasium, and a study that leads to a separate office space.

The first-floor accommodation comprises six bedrooms, five of which have en suite facilities, including a spacious guest bedroom with an adjoining dressing room.

The grounds are predominantly composed of substantial lawned areas flanked by mature deciduous woodland, offering privacy and tranquillity. The large annexe previously served as a garage block but currently functions as a music room, workshop, and games room/bar area above. With some modifications, the annexe presents potential for multi-generational living or the ground floor could be converted back to garaging. The main residence also benefits from a double garage and additional storage.

Location
Brackenhill Hall Farm is situated close to the village of Cawood, notable as the location of the Cawood sword. The property lies just south of the point where the River Wharfe flows into the River Ouse, which forms the northern boundary of the village and is crossed by the Cawood swing-bridge. The village benefits from three public houses, a post office and general store, a tea room, and Cawood Church of England Primary School.

The property is well-positioned for access to the market town of Selby, approximately five miles away, and the historic city of York, around nine miles distant, offering both attractions and rail links. Additionally, Leeds (sixteen miles) and Bradford (twenty-five miles) are within commuting distance.

York and Leeds have direct rail connections to London Kings Cross, while Leeds Bradford International Airport is approximately twenty-one miles from the property.
